To maintain edge profile integrity, ProNest 8 allows complete control over material piercing points. It manages the placement of lead-ins and lead-outs to ensure that the initial blow-through gouge of the plasma or laser torch occurs safely inside the scrap skeleton rather than on the finished part boundary. 4. One of the defining advantages of ProNest 8 is its native support for Hypertherm's technologies. Features like True Hole® , which produces significantly rounder bolt holes in plasma cutting, and Rapid Part™ , which accelerates cutting on thin gauge material, are embedded directly into the software and applied automatically without operator intervention. This integration ensures that your Hypertherm plasma system consistently delivers the highest quality cuts.

To increase throughput and conserve consumables, ProNest 8 includes advanced features like , where two adjacent parts share a single cut line, and bridge/chain cutting , which keeps parts connected to the skeleton for easier handling. The software also performs cutting path optimization to minimize torch travel and reduce heat distortion.
